Ordinals
beta
Address bc1q9qsyjc2zhwu988rmkjwr48wux7lcej42ev6htf
sat balance
11438843
outputs
90fb604f6b01030fa354a8f97e8931fba4a7a64f23839481377420723057622d:147
a7c65aec001c74619723a71ab1c33fa654c9ba5bd22bee8db4d7b3139e3fdd2e:141
d2526c6aef94af39e174cce8c4b8921ada61a487f876e0f8506e4abc3afe6366:439